Output 42e3e58ec85eb3aec8636eeb967dc80bf757f209423abddaec0046ac34ce3b50:19

value
201820000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89aac4f387d64d5632b19408b13be24c51f67857 OP_EQUALVERIFY OP_CHECKSIG
address
1DYv9YUH1KhLW88BQyLd73YH9sNvNpJHQx
transaction
42e3e58ec85eb3aec8636eeb967dc80bf757f209423abddaec0046ac34ce3b50
spent
true